The North Dakota Department of Agriculture is investigating additional possible cases of Palmer amaranth. Plants found in McIntosh County, near where the first confirmed case was found, have been sent on for additional DNA testing. Farmers in that area are encouraged to scout and if suspicious weeds are found, should contact local weed officers, extension agents or other experts. The Agriculture Department is hosting meetings with local landowners to discuss scouting techniques.
